A chemist decided to determine the molecular formula of an unknown compound. He collects following informations: (P) Compound contains 2:1 H to O atom (number fo atoms).
(Q) Compound has 40% C by mass
(R) Approximate molecular mass of the compound is 178 g.
(S) Compound contains C,H and O only.
What is the empirical formula of the compound?

A

`CH_(3)O`

B

`CH_(2)O`

C

`C_(2)H_(2)O`

D

`CH_(3)O_(2)`

Text Solution

Verified by Experts

The correct Answer is:
B
